Today I visited the Banco Central office in Santiago to enquire.
I was wondering about opening a currency exchange business. There is certainly one unfilled need, in Dajabón, where there is no bank or exchange house handling Haitian gourdes.
The guy phoned Santo Domingo to find somebody who could help me. To my surprise, it is illegal to exchange Haitian money in the Dominican Republic because it is not on the list of currencies that licensed agencies are allowed to exchange,
